Supply Concentration

Supply concentration is the degree to which a cryptocurrency's circulating supply is held within a small number of wallet addresses, measured as the percentage of total supply controlled by the largest cohorts.

Supply Shock

A supply shock in cryptocurrency is a condition where the liquid supply available for purchase contracts sharply relative to existing or growing demand, creating upward price pressure through constrained market availability.
